Veteran actor Rajinikanth's upcoming film, 'Vettaiyan', will release in October this year. The makers, on Sunday, shared a brand-new poster of the south superstar from the film as they announced its release.
Lyca Productions, which will be distributing 'Vettaiyan', shared the poster featuring a gun-wielding Rajinikanth. "Kuri vechachu. VETTAIYAN is all set to take charge in cinemas this OCTOBER. Get ready to chase down the prey
(sic)", read the full caption of the post.
According to rumours, 'Vettaiyan' is a hard-hitting action entertainer based on a true story. It is said that the actor will play a Muslim police officer in the film.
In an earlier interaction, Rajinikanth said that Gnanavel's 'Vettaiyan' is likely to be wrapped up by the end of March. He will then take a break and move on to director Lokesh Kanagaraj's 'Thalaivar 171'.
